If you're experiencing issues with uploaded files or knowledge documents in Magai, this guide will help you troubleshoot common problems. Whether your files are stuck in "pending" status or the AI isn't using your uploaded documents as expected, follow these steps to resolve the issue.
Common Issues and Solutions
1. Check Your Document Status
First, verify the status of your uploaded document in either your workspace or persona settings:
Pending Status: The document is still processing and not ready for use
Success Status: The document has been processed and is available for the AI to use
Failed Status: The upload or processing encountered an error
If your document shows "Pending":
Wait 2-5 minutes for processing to complete
If it remains pending longer than 5 minutes, the processing has likely failed (even if not explicitly labeled as failed)
Delete the file and try uploading again
If the issue persists after multiple attempts, contact our support team through the in-app support messenger

2. Add Clear Instructions for Document Usage
If your file shows "Success" status but the AI isn't using it, you need to provide explicit instructions telling the AI when, why, and how to use your uploaded documents.
For Workspace Documents:
Add instructions to your workspace custom context, such as:
You have been given access to these files: [list your file names]. You will use these files for the purpose of [specify the purpose, e.g., "answering questions about our company policies," "providing product information," etc.]. Reference these documents whenever users ask questions related to [specify relevant topics].
For Persona Documents:
Add similar instructions to your persona settings:
You have access to uploaded knowledge files containing [describe content]. Use these files when users ask about [relevant topics] or when you need to provide specific information about [subject matter].
Important: Don't leave document usage to chance. Always provide clear, specific instructions about:
When the AI should access the files
Why it should use them
How they should be referenced
What topics or questions they relate to

3. Verify Your AI Model Supports Actions
Ensure you're using an AI model that has "actions enabled." Models with actions can utilize tools like knowledge retrieval to access your uploaded files.
To check if your model supports actions:
Look for models labeled with actions capability
Models without actions enabled cannot access uploaded knowledge files
Switch to a compatible model if needed

Additional Troubleshooting Tips
File Format: Ensure your documents are in supported formats
File Size: Check that your files aren't too large for processing
Content Quality: Make sure uploaded documents contain clear, readable text
Network Issues: If uploads fail repeatedly, check your internet connection
